2012-11-26 2 views
0

mod-rewrite를 사용하여 codeigniter에 2 개의 uri 세그먼트를 삭제해도 기능을 유지할 수 있습니까?Mod_Rewrite를 사용하여 URI 세그먼트를 삭제하십시오. Codeigniter

codeigniter 라우트를 사용하고 싶지 않습니다. 왜냐하면 필자가 필요로하지 않기 때문입니다. http://site.com/royal-blue-choir-stole

가 어떻게 오픈 소스 CMS 유사한 URL을, 기능을 유지하지만 다시 쓸 수 있나요 : I가 변경 모드 - 재 작성을 사용하려면 http://site.com/product/details/3/royal-blue-choir-stole

:

나는 긴 URL이 시스템이 그것을합니까?

나의 현재 htaccess로 파일은 URL에서 index.php를 제거하는 코드가 있습니다 ...

RewriteEngine on 
RewriteCond %{REQUEST_FILENAME} !-f 
RewriteCond %{REQUEST_FILENAME} !-d 
RewriteRule .* index.php/$0 [PT,L] 

답변

0

이 같은 시도를

RewriteRule ^(.*)$ index.php?product/details/$0 [PT,L] 
관련 문제